Herein, what is globalscape EFT Server?
EFT from Globalscape is an advanced, powerful managed file transfer (MFT) solution that replaces insecure legacy FTP servers, inflexible and haphazard home-grown file transfer systems, slow physical shipment of data, and expensive leased lines and VANs.
Furthermore, what is enhanced transfer? Enhanced File Transfer (EFT) is an industry-leading enterprise file transfer platform that delivers military-grade security for achieving best-in-class control and visibility of data in motion or at rest across multiple locations.

What is electronic file transfer?
On the Internet, the File Transfer Protocol (FTP) is a common way to transfer a single file or a relatively small number of files from one computer to another. Electronic Data Interchange (EDI) is a popular protocol for transferring files in a routine manner between businesses.
